Work with a leading civil engineering contractor delivering essential water infrastructure upgrades. This is a fantastic opportunity to join a dynamic team on a flagship water treatment project, supporting the delivery of critical works for a major utilities client.

Your new role as a Contract Site Engineer will involve:

  • Setting out and surveying works, ensuring technical accuracy and compliance with project specifications.
  • Coordinating subcontractors and ensuring works are delivered to programme and quality standards.
  • Maintaining site records, as-built drawings, and inspection/test documentation.
  • Liaising with clients, designers, and stakeholders to ensure smooth project delivery.

Requirements:

  • Previous experience as a Site Engineer on water treatment or heavy civils projects.
  • Strong setting out and surveying skills (Leica/Trimble preferred).
  • Valid CSCS card and full UK driving licence.

Competitive daily rate and opportunity to work on a high-profile infrastructure project. Immediate start and potential for contract extension.
